How can I convert a set to a list in Python?
You can convert a set to a list using the list()
function. For example, my_list = list(my_set)
.
What if my set contains different data types?
The list()
function will handle different data types in a set without any issues. Each element will be converted to a list item.
Can you show me an example?
Sure! If you have a set like my_set = {1, 'apple', 3.14}
, you can convert it to a list with my_list = list(my_set)
, resulting in my_list = [1, 'apple', 3.14]
.
Is the order of elements preserved in the list?
No, sets are unordered collections, so the order of elements in the resulting list may vary.
